Default Precedent helper spring

I have a 07 precedent electric. It has a jakes 6in lift with rear seat. Occasionally there is some rubbing in the rear. I don't want to add full on hd springs and or mess with removing a leaf etc. I was wondering if anyone has used this helper spring in the link below. Will it work on a lifted precedent?
